Ubisoft try something magical with the latest Assassin’s Creed Unity trailer

Ubisoft have never been one to go about things the easy way and today they have released the latest interactive trailer for Assassin’s Creed Unity.

Unveiling a revolutionary interactive trailer which has been co-created by the community, you’ll get to experience a breathtaking dive straight into the heart of the French Revolution.

Created over several months, the community created and then voted on their favourite Assassins and of the 200,000 created, the top 1400 have made the cut. Check out the trailer at the link below because at any moment in time, it can be paused allowing you to zoom in on any Assassin. A gigapan will also be released that features every single Assassin’s in the one image.

But that’s not all, look carefully and you’ll be able to discover 15 secrets allowing access to exclusive footage and content.

It’s all pretty remarkable and rings true with the sense of involvement Ubisoft want you to feel with their latest AC creation.

Assassin’s Creed Unity will be released in the UK on November 14th.
